引言
随着互联网技术的不断发展,网络通信的需求日益增长,对网络性能和可靠性的要求也越来越高。BGP(Border Gateway Protocol)作为互联网中最重要的路由协议之一,承担着将数据包从源网络转发到目的网络的重任。本文将深入探讨BGP双线轮廓共生的无限可能,分析其背后的技术原理和应用场景。
BGP简介
BGP是一种用于自治系统(AS)之间的路由协议。它允许不同自治系统之间的路由器交换路由信息,从而实现互联网上的数据传输。BGP的特点是支持复杂的路由策略和丰富的路由属性。
双线轮廓共生
双线轮廓共生是指在同一网络环境中,通过两条独立的线路(例如,光纤和微波)接入不同的互联网运营商,从而实现网络冗余和优化路由的目的。
技术原理
- 路由分离:通过在BGP中配置路由分离,可以实现对不同线路的路由进行独立管理。
- 路由聚合:通过聚合相同目的地址的路由,可以减少路由表的大小,提高路由选择效率。
- 路由策略:通过配置BGP的路由策略,可以实现对不同线路的流量进行控制和优化。
应用场景
- 提高网络可靠性:当一条线路出现故障时,另一条线路可以接管流量,保证网络的持续运行。
- 优化网络性能:通过选择最佳路径,可以实现网络传输的优化。
- 降低成本:通过共享线路资源,可以降低网络建设成本。
BGP双线轮廓共生的实现步骤
- 网络规划:确定网络拓扑结构,选择合适的线路接入点。
- 设备配置:配置路由器,包括IP地址、BGP邻居等。
- 路由策略配置:配置路由分离、路由聚合和路由策略。
- 监控与优化:实时监控网络性能,根据实际情况进行调整。
实例分析
以下是一个简单的BGP双线轮廓共生的实例:
自治系统AS1000
接入运营商A
IP地址范围:192.168.1.0/24
BGP邻居:192.168.1.2
接入运营商B
IP地址范围:192.168.2.0/24
BGP邻居:192.168.2.2
在路由器上配置BGP:
RouterA(config)#router bgp 1000
RouterA(config-router)#network 192.168.1.0 mask 255.255.255.0
RouterA(config-router)#neighbor 192.168.1.2 remote-as 1000
RouterB(config)#router bgp 1000
RouterB(config-router)#network 192.168.2.0 mask 255.255.255.0
RouterB(config-router)#neighbor 192.168.2.2 remote-as 1000
结论
BGP双线轮廓共生为网络提供了更高的可靠性、性能和灵活性。通过合理的规划、配置和优化,可以实现网络资源的最大化利用,为用户提供优质的网络服务。